Setup: Gamma in ChatGPT

ChatGPT adds MCP servers via custom connectors in developer mode. The gateway route takes about two minutes:

  1. Connect Gamma to your free gate gateway from the verified directory.
  2. Open ChatGPT → Settings → Connectors and enable Developer mode under Advanced.
  3. Click 'Create', name it 'gate', paste your gateway URL, and set authentication to OAuth.
  4. Approve the authorization — Gamma is now available in your ChatGPT conversations.
